In pre-clinical models, BPC 157 has been observed to: Upregulate vascular endothelial growth factor (VEGF) , promoting new blood vessel formation in damaged tissue Modulate nitric oxide (NO) synthesis pathways, influencing vascular tone and healing cascades Interact with the growth hormone receptor system , potentially amplifying downstream tissue repair signaling Demonstrate cytoprotective effects along the gastrointestinal tract its native home territory as a gastric peptide Exhibit apparent neuroprotective properties in rodent models of CNS injury BPC 157 stability in gastric acid unusual for peptides has made it a focus of GI mucosal repair research
